On 24.07.26 11:05, [email protected] wrote:
> From: Pankaj Gupta <[email protected]>
> 
> Reserve 1MB of DDR memory region due to EdgeLock Enclave's hardware
> limitation restricting access to DDR addresses from 0x80000000
> to 0xafffffff.

> +		ele_reserved: memory@90000000 {
> +			compatible = "shared-dma-pool";
> +			reg = <0 0x90000000 0 0x100000>;

Instead of using a fixed address here, why not use 'alloc-ranges' to
specify a valid range and let the kernel decide on where to reserve the
1MB area?

As mentioned for the other patch, I would prefer a universal default for
the memory node in a dtsi that can be used by all imx8ulp boards. See
[1] for the i.MX93 proposal.
